Author:  A. Klenin  Time limit:  1 sec  
Input file:  input.txt  Memory limit:  256 Mb  
Output file:  output.txt 
Consider a sequence of numbers a_{1}, …, a_{N}, representing heights. Let's say that element a_{i} has a visibility radius d if a_{i} ≥ a_{j} for all j such that 1 ≤ j ≤ N and i − j < d.
You task is to find maximum d_{i} for every a_{i}.
Input file contains integer N followed by N integers a_{i}.
Output file must contain N integers d_{i} — maximum visibility for every a_{i}. If maximum visibility radius for element a_{i} is unlimited, output d_{i} = 0.
1 ≤ N ≤ 10^{6}, 0 ≤ a_{i} ≤ 10^{9}
